The third volume of this monumental Chinese literary classic concludes the story of the illustrious Jia family with powerful emotional depth and poetic nuance. Originally penned in the 18th century, A Dream of Red Mansions is regarded as one of China's Four Great Classical Novels. This 1980 edition, translated into English and published by Foreign Languages Press in Peking, preserves the story's richness with fine artwork by Tai Tun-Pang.
